Kazakhstan not to ban Russian rocket launches from Baikonur

ASTANA. August 27. KAZINFORM Kazakhstan does not plan to ban launches of Russian rockets from its space center in Baikonur after accident with Progress M-12M space freighter, Talgat Musabayev, the head of the Kazakh space agency, Kazcosmos, said.

photo: QAZINFORM

According to RIA Novosti, Musabayev said it was not right to immediately ban the launches as the rockets were being successfully launched for already more than 40 years.

"This is the first failure out of 136 launches . It is an eco-friendly rocket. The accident has not done any harm to Kazakhstan," Musabayev said.

Musabayev also added he categorically ruled out any possibility that parts of the rocket might have fallen on the territory of Kazakhstan.
